Peak
is a mountain of , . The mountain rises up over the town of Leonberg, at a height of 480.60 metres. Originally known as Endelberg, it has been called by its current name since the 16th century.

Castle
Photo: BuzzWoof, Public domain.
Schloss Leonberg was founded in 1248 by count Ulrich I of Württemberg. The original castle was modified between 1560 and 1565 by the master builder Aberlin Tretsch by order of the duke Christoph. is situated 480 metres west of Friedhof Seestraße.
